Estilização de <code>ins</code> e <code>del</code>

Would it be possible to add the following styling for <ins> and <del>?

ins { text-decoration: underline; }
del { text-decoration: line-through; }

Example:

But soft, what light through thatyonder window breaks?

Red for deletions and green for insertions are very much conventional. Word processor features, such as Word’s Track Changes, universally use underlining and strikeout, as well. The default stylesheet of my Chrome browser does likewise. But I just see background-colored text on Discourse forums.

I suspect Discourse’s CSS reset may be clobbering it.

6 curtidas

Relying on color alone is a little rough for red-green colorblind people, so that could help here too… simulated example:

Screen Shot 2021-11-02 at 1.30.56 PM

5 curtidas

I suppose it’s also worth considering whether the color cue should be background, color, or both.

2 curtidas

Então você está sugerindo que usemos ambas cor e sublinhado/risco aqui? Para mim tudo bem, @awesomerobot se você quiser incluir isso, parece uma mudança pequena e fácil.

1 curtida

A norma no direito é texto verde e sublinhado para inserções e texto vermelho e tachado para exclusões. Acredito que a diferença de prosa do GitHub faça fundo verde e sublinhado para inserções e fundo vermelho e tachado para exclusões.

Eu recomendaria fortemente combinar cor e decoração de texto. Não tenho uma opinião forte sobre se devo colorir o texto, o fundo ou ambos, desde que a abordagem para inserções e exclusões seja a mesma.

Também pode valer a pena pensar no modo escuro. Acabei de abrir uma diferença de prosa do GitHub e é difícil ver a estilização no fundo cinza do modo escuro.

3 curtidas

Para mim tudo bem, se o @awesomerobot for a favor, vamos lá!

4 curtidas

Notei que o GitHub apenas faz sublinhado e riscado para \\u003cins\u003e e \\u003cdel\u003e em comentários. Mas posso confirmar que sinto falta da cor. É difícil identificar todas as alterações em um grande bloco de conteúdo rapidamente sem as dicas de cor.

4 curtidas

Ainda a favor. Se @awesomerobot concordar, vamos em frente.

2 curtidas

Isso afetaria todo mundo? Eu uso isso para destacar. LOL

4 curtidas

Isso afetaria a todos, mas <mark> também funciona para <mark>realce</mark>!

Acho que deveríamos fazer tanto a estilização de cor quanto de texto; chegaremos a isso, é apenas baixa prioridade.

3 curtidas
8 curtidas

Verdade, mas o verde e o vermelho oferecem mais opções. Poderia ser uma configuração para destacar apenas ou adicionar estilo de texto?

Eu os usei bastante em blogs. Isso os mudará completamente.

exemplo:

2 curtidas

Kris precisará confirmar 100%, mas tenho 99% de certeza de que podemos substituir rapidamente o novo sublinhado/riscado por meio de um componente de tema em seu site.

3 curtidas

Sim, com certeza! Atualizarei seu tema para que não haja nenhuma alteração!

4 curtidas

Talvez @ThunderThighs gostaria de estilos para mark.red, mark.green, mark.blue, e assim por diante?

Muitos amigos que usam marcadores gostam de ter várias cores deles.
Você também pode considerar conteúdo :before e :after para leitores de tela se a codificação por cores for importante. Caso contrário, entendo que muitos leitores de tela não pronunciam tags mark, apenas seu conteúdo.

5 curtidas